Shaykh Ahmad Musa Jibril Ahmad Musa Jibril is a prominent Palestinian-American Salafi cleric based in Dearborn, Michigan, recognized as one of the most influential English-speaking spiritual figures for Western foreign fighters during the rise of the Syrian Civil War. He is known for a teaching style that combines traditional Salafi education with highly emotive political rhetoric, positioning him as a "cheerleader" for armed opposition while often avoiding direct, prosecutable incitement to violence.
